Static Dielectric Breakdown Strength of Condensed Heterogeneous High Explosives
Abstract
A new method of obtaining static dielectric breakdown strength data is reported. The breakdown strengths of plastic bonded explosives have been obtained using this method. The theory of dielectric breakdown in solid materials, including explosives, is presented. The difficulties associated with the measurement of dielectric breakdown strengths are then analyzed in detail, and using this analysis, a new test method is described.
